New format of application settings files
Due to modifications in the underlying software technology WinIQSIM2 now stores
application settings in a new file format (extension: “.savrcltxt”). The program offers to
load settings stored with previous versions of WinIQSIM2 (extension: “.savrcl”) and will
convert them into the new file format. The original files will be deleted in the process.
Please make backup copies of your settings files if you plan to go back to an earlier
version of WinIQSIM2.

2 Installing the Software
2.1 Uninstall old software version (skip, if this is a first-time
installation)
To uninstall a previous version of WinIQSIM2 click on the Windows Start button and go to Settings / Control Panel / Add or Remove Programs. Then select the previously installed version of WinIQSIM2 to uninstall it.
2.2 Install new software version
Supported operating systems: Windows Vista Windows 7 Windows 8 Windows 10
Administrator rights are necessary for installation and startingWinIQSIM2.
Uninstall any previous version of WinIQSIM2 before installing the new software.
In Windows Explorer double-click WinIQSIM2xxxxx.exe and follow instructions.
